const { logLevel, Kafka } = require('kafkajs');
const config = require('config'),
JsInvokeMessageProcessor = require('../../api/jsInvokeMessageProcessor'),
logger = require('../../config/logger')._logger('main'),
KafkaJsWinstonLogCreator = require('../../config/logger').KafkaJsWinstonLogCreator;
var kafkaClient;
var consumer;
var producer;
function KafkaProducer() {
this.send = async (responseTopic, scriptId, rawResponse, headers) => {
return producer.send(
{
topic: responseTopic,
messages: [
{
key: scriptId,
value: rawResponse,
headers: headers
}
]
});
}
}
(async() => {
try {
logger.info('Starting ThingsBoard JavaScript Executor Microservice...');
const kafkaBootstrapServers = config.get('kafka.bootstrap.servers');
const kafkaRequestTopic = config.get('kafka.request_topic');
logger.info('Kafka Bootstrap Servers: %s', kafkaBootstrapServers);
logger.info('Kafka Requests Topic: %s', kafkaRequestTopic);
kafkaClient = new Kafka({
brokers: kafkaBootstrapServers.split(','),
logLevel: logLevel.INFO,
logCreator: KafkaJsWinstonLogCreator
});
consumer = kafkaClient.consumer({ groupId: 'js-executor-group' });
producer = kafkaClient.producer();
const messageProcessor = new JsInvokeMessageProcessor(new KafkaProducer());
await consumer.connect();
await producer.connect();
await consumer.subscribe({ topic: kafkaRequestTopic});
logger.info('Started ThingsBoard JavaScript Executor Microservice.');
await consumer.run({
eachMessage: async ({ topic, partition, message }) => {
messageProcessor.onJsInvokeMessage(message);
},
});
} catch (e) {
logger.error('Failed to start ThingsBoard JavaScript Executor Microservice: %s', e.message);
logger.error(e.stack);
exit(-1);
}
})();
process.on('exit', () => {
exit(0);
});
async function exit(status) {
logger.info('Exiting with status: %d ...', status);
if (consumer) {
logger.info('Stopping Kafka Consumer...');
var _consumer = consumer;
consumer = null;
try {
await _consumer.disconnect();
logger.info('Kafka Consumer stopped.');
await disconnectProducer();
process.exit(status);
} catch (e) {
logger.info('Kafka Consumer stop error.');
await disconnectProducer();
process.exit(status);
}
} else {
process.exit(status);
}
}
async function disconnectProducer() {
if (producer) {
logger.info('Stopping Kafka Producer...');
var _producer = producer;
producer = null;
try {
await _producer.disconnect();
logger.info('Kafka Producer stopped.');
} catch (e) {
logger.info('Kafka Producer stop error.');
}
}
}
